Just adding to my previous review one year later. Since August last year I have been trad climbing with the Sharp double in the Dolomites, Yosemite & Tuolumne, and other places. The ropes show excellent abrasion resistance despite of the increasing mileage. They also caught a few low F-factor falls without issue or damage. I highly recommend the rope.

Tech Specs:
- Thickness:
- 8.5mm
- Type:
- Half Rope (Double Rope)
- Length:
- 60m and 70m
- Dry:
- Yes
- Sheath Construction:
- Double-pick
- Impact Force:
- ~5.4kN (with 80kg)
- Elongation:
- 10%
- Center Mark:
- No
- Falls:
- 9
- Recommended Use:
- Alpine, Traditional, Ice, Big-Wall
- Weight:
- 48g/m
